Jatin Ahuja (born 1987) is an Indian entrepreneur and the founder of Big Boy Toyz.
Early life and education[edit]
Ahuja was born in Delhi to a chartered accountant father. He studied at Mata Jai Kaur Public School in Ashok Vihar, Delhi and completed his B.Tech from Maharshi Dayanand University in 2002.[1]
Personal life[edit]
In October, 2013 he married Ritika and the couple have a daughter.[2]
Career[edit]
Ahuja started his career as an entrepreneur at the age of 17. In 2015, he bought a Mercedes-Benz S-Class that had been damaged in the Mumbai floods, he refurbished the car and sold it for a profit of Rs 25 lakh. in 2009, Jatin founded Big Boy Toyz a company that purchases pre-owned luxury cars and resells after refurbishing them. The annual turnover of the company is around 225–250 crores Indian rupees in the fiscal year ended March 2018.[3][4][5]
In 2017, Ahuja was named in the Entrepreneur Magazine's 35 Under 35 - The Game Changers of India list.[6]
